Searched refs:key_spec (Results 1 – 6 of 6) sorted by relevance
| /linux/fs/crypto/ |
| A D | keyring.c | 477 struct fscrypt_key_specifier *key_spec) in add_master_key() argument 496 key_spec->u.identifier, in add_master_key() 501 return do_add_master_key(sb, secret, key_spec); in add_master_key() 642 if (!valid_key_spec(&arg.key_spec)) in fscrypt_ioctl_add_key() 674 err = add_master_key(sb, &secret, &arg.key_spec); in fscrypt_ioctl_add_key() 681 copy_to_user(uarg->key_spec.u.identifier, arg.key_spec.u.identifier, in fscrypt_ioctl_add_key() 697 struct fscrypt_key_specifier *key_spec) in fscrypt_add_test_dummy_key() argument 709 err = add_master_key(sb, &secret, key_spec); in fscrypt_add_test_dummy_key() 925 if (!valid_key_spec(&arg.key_spec)) in do_remove_key() 940 key = fscrypt_find_master_key(sb, &arg.key_spec); in do_remove_key() [all …]
|
| A D | policy.c | 726 struct fscrypt_key_specifier key_spec = { 0 }; in fscrypt_set_test_dummy_encryption() local 736 key_spec.type = FSCRYPT_KEY_SPEC_TYPE_DESCRIPTOR; in fscrypt_set_test_dummy_encryption() 737 memset(key_spec.u.descriptor, 0x42, in fscrypt_set_test_dummy_encryption() 741 key_spec.type = FSCRYPT_KEY_SPEC_TYPE_IDENTIFIER; in fscrypt_set_test_dummy_encryption() 754 err = fscrypt_add_test_dummy_key(sb, &key_spec); in fscrypt_set_test_dummy_encryption() 763 memcpy(policy->v1.master_key_descriptor, key_spec.u.descriptor, in fscrypt_set_test_dummy_encryption() 769 memcpy(policy->v2.master_key_identifier, key_spec.u.identifier, in fscrypt_set_test_dummy_encryption()
|
| A D | fscrypt_private.h | 549 struct fscrypt_key_specifier *key_spec);
|
| /linux/tools/include/uapi/linux/ |
| A D | fscrypt.h | 124 struct fscrypt_key_specifier key_spec; member 133 struct fscrypt_key_specifier key_spec; member 143 struct fscrypt_key_specifier key_spec; member
|
| /linux/include/uapi/linux/ |
| A D | fscrypt.h | 124 struct fscrypt_key_specifier key_spec; member 133 struct fscrypt_key_specifier key_spec; member 143 struct fscrypt_key_specifier key_spec; member
|
| /linux/Documentation/filesystems/ |
| A D | fscrypt.rst | 685 struct fscrypt_key_specifier key_spec; 716 ``key_spec.u.descriptor`` must contain the descriptor of the key 723 policies, then ``key_spec.type`` must contain 739 the raw key and whose ``type`` field matches ``key_spec.type``. 865 struct fscrypt_key_specifier key_spec; 874 - The key to remove is specified by ``key_spec``: 884 in ``key_spec.u.identifier``. 962 struct fscrypt_key_specifier key_spec; 976 The caller must zero all input fields, then fill in ``key_spec``: 980 in ``key_spec.u.descriptor``. [all …]
|
Completed in 18 milliseconds